Job Summary

  • The role contributes to the overall success of the National Accounts Team by executing business strategies and ensuring compliance with regulations.
  • The incumbent manages a customer portfolio of moderate to higher complexity, targeting clients with credit authorizations over $25MM and annual sales exceeding $75MM.
  • The position requires strong risk assessment and credit skills to structure deals, analyze financial statements, and provide sound recommendations on pricing and terms.
